水溶性維生素(WSV)主要由維生素B複合物組成,是許多食品的基本成分,尤其是在嬰兒配方食品中。在分析強化食品時,由於需要符合每日的攝入量,維生素的濃度範圍很廣,這一點尤其具有挑戰性。本應用介紹了一種LC-MS/MS方法,用於嬰兒配方食品中B族維生素的高效、常規和穩定的色譜分析。很寬濃度範圍內的八種水溶性維生素被鑒定出來,並在4分鍾內定量。結果表明,保留時間重複性好,該方法能夠在0.5 ppb的濃度下檢測維生素B12,遠低於嬰兒配方奶粉中預期水平的約2 ppb。

獸藥在畜牧生產中用於治療疾病,預防感染和保護動物的生長,這有助於提供高質量的市場。然而,不加控製的使用可能會導致嚴重的人類疾病,因此世界各地的監管機構都製定了食品中獸藥的最大殘留量(MRL)或耐受量。由於樣品基質的複雜性和不同化學性質分析物的多樣性,獸藥殘留分析通常具有挑戰性。本研究中,采用溶劑萃取結合液相色譜-質譜聯用技術,建立了雞肉樣品中73種獸藥(包括13種不同化學類別)的快速、靈敏、選擇性分析方法。
多環芳烴(PAHs)在煙熏、加熱和幹燥過程中會汙染食品,這些過程會使燃燒產物直接接觸到食品。它們還可以通過受汙染的空氣和水進入食物供應鏈,並在各種食物鏈中積累。相關機構製定了相關法規來監測食品中多環芳烴的含量;歐盟對熏魚和熏製水產品肉中的BaP設定了嚴格的最大殘留限量(MRL)為2µg/kg。在本研究中,海產品采用QueChERS萃取法,然後采用分散固相萃取淨化步驟製備。隨後,通過超高壓液相色譜-三重四極杆質譜儀聯用係統對樣品進行分析。
農藥被用於農作物生長中防止一些害蟲和真菌的危害。當種植作物用於在畜牧業中生產飼料時,飼料中可能殘留農藥,對牲畜攝入農藥構成風險。農藥殘留由多個政府機構監管,因此需要有足夠穩健的分析方法來分析各種複雜基質中的分析物,同時也需要具有足夠的靈敏度和選擇性,以滿足嚴格的法規要求。在本應用說明中,開發了一種快速、靈敏和高選擇性的多殘留分析方法,用於分析動物飼料中的94種農藥,報告限值低於歐盟委員會0.01 mg/kg的最大殘留限量。

眾所周知,黑胡椒基質複雜,需要合適的提取和清除幹擾的方法。本研究建立了一種快速、靈敏、選擇性的多殘留方法用於分析胡椒樣品中超過136種農藥,方法采用改進的QuEChERS提取方法與LC/MS/MS結合,利用了QSight™ 三重四極杆質譜儀中的時間管理-MRM。針對目標分析物,可自動生成多個MRM通道的最佳駐留時間。這不僅節省了方法開發的時間,而且提高了儀器的數據質量和分析性能。

丙烯酰胺是一種可能致癌的有機化合物,存在於一些高溫烹調的食物中。它源於氨基酸天冬酰胺和葡萄糖發生美拉德反應。2002年,在炸薯條和烤麵包中發現了丙烯酰胺。這種化合物現在也在一些其他食物中被發現,如咖啡、黑橄欖、幹梨和花生。結果是世界衛生組織立即限製了它在食品中的存在。
